Finance M&A Integration & Analysis Manager

This position is listed on behalf of a partner company, who manages all applications and next steps. Our partner is looking for a Finance M&A Integration & Analysis Manager based in the United States.

This role plays a key part in supporting a growing acquisition strategy by leading finance integration activities across newly acquired businesses. You’ll operate at the intersection of M&A due diligence, financial planning, integration execution, and post-acquisition performance management. The position offers broad exposure across Finance, Accounting, IT, Data & Analytics, Operations, and external advisors. You’ll help ensure acquired businesses transition effectively into established financial, reporting, and operational environments. The role combines financial modeling, analytical problem-solving, project leadership, and strategic thinking in a fast-paced environment. You’ll also help develop repeatable integration processes and best practices as acquisition activity expands. It’s an opportunity for an M&A-focused finance professional to have a direct impact on both transaction success and long-term business performance.

Accountabilities:

  • Support M&A due diligence: Review financial information, operational metrics, business assumptions, and forecasts for prospective acquisitions, helping assess opportunities, risks, and potential synergies.
  • Prepare pre-close integration plans: Evaluate target financial data structures, charts of accounts, reporting frameworks, and other requirements to establish effective integration plans before transaction close.
  • Lead finance integration: Manage finance-related integration activities for acquired businesses, coordinating the transition of financial data, reporting structures, budgeting processes, and other core finance capabilities.
  • Coordinate systems and data migration: Partner with Accounting, IT, Data & Analytics, Operations, and other stakeholders to facilitate system conversions, data migration, and alignment with enterprise processes.
  • Support purchase accounting: Coordinate with internal teams and external advisors to support purchase accounting activities and ensure appropriate financial integration.
  • Establish performance reporting: Develop reporting processes, KPIs, and performance metrics for newly acquired businesses to provide visibility into post-acquisition results.
  • Track synergies and acquisition performance: Build and maintain synergy tracking, monitor performance against investment theses and forecast assumptions, and identify opportunities or risks requiring action.
  • Develop executive reporting: Prepare post-acquisition business reviews, financial analyses, and executive-level reporting that support decision-making and performance management.
  • Support earn-out analysis: Assist with earn-out calculations, performance monitoring, and related financial analyses.
  • Drive strategic finance projects: Lead or support special initiatives involving process improvement, reporting enhancements, operational scalability, and evolving business priorities.
  • Build scalable integration practices: Develop repeatable methodologies, tools, and best practices that improve the efficiency and consistency of future acquisition integrations.
